WebBreastfeeding jaundice can occur when a newborn does not get a good start on breastfeeding, has an improper latch, or is supplemented with other substitutes which interfere with breastfeeding. Breastfeeding jaundice often will resolve itself with increased feedings and help from a lactation consultant to make sure the baby is taking in adequate ... http://www.makingkanefitforkids.org/wordpress/wp-content/files_mf/kaiserpermanenterbreastfeedingteachingguide.pdf

WebNNF Teaching Aids: Newborn Care 1. Mother should be motivated right from the antenatal period. Her breasts should be examined and she should be informed about the benefits of breast feeding. 2. Every health care facility must have a written breastfeeding policy .One should arrange mother craft classes in the hospitals. 3.
